A visual representation of the belt routing for a specific Exmark Quest mower model provides a crucial reference for maintenance and repair. This schematic typically illustrates the path the belt follows around the engine, deck spindles, and idler pulleys. An accurate depiction is essential for correct installation and tensioning, ensuring optimal power transfer and minimizing wear.

Proper belt routing is fundamental to the efficient operation of a mower. Incorrect installation can lead to premature belt failure, decreased cutting performance, and potential damage to other components. Access to a clear schematic simplifies maintenance tasks, reduces downtime, and ultimately contributes to the longevity of the machine. Historically, these diagrams were primarily found in service manuals; however, the rise of online resources has significantly improved accessibility for owners and technicians.

A visual representation of the power transmission system on an Exmark Quest mower, this schematic illustrates the routing and placement of the belt that drives the cutting deck and other components. It typically identifies the various pulleys, belt tensioners, and their interrelationships, often including part numbers for easy identification and replacement.

Accurate routing of the drive belt is crucial for proper mower function. This visual guide simplifies maintenance, troubleshooting, and repair by clearly showing the correct belt path. Access to this illustration can save significant time and prevent costly mistakes during these processes, ultimately extending the lifespan of the mower and ensuring optimal performance.
